http://www.independent.ie/lifestyle/...bb-690711.html Oh, brother! Basking in BB Sunday June 03 2007 ORWELL would be proud. Okay, maybe that's pushing it, but this time around, the 1984 author might recognise something of his vision in Big Brother. Not, of course, that he ever imagined it would become a reality that police would be paid to watch surveillance of the general public in order to pass or punish their behaviour. But then, even Orwell's grim imagining of the future did not foresee the deep desire to be observed and applauded or booed that has Big Brother entering its eighth series, this time with the police watching Thanks to Jade Goody and her coven's bullying of Bollywood actress Shilpa Shetty in the last Celebrity Big Brother, a squad of British police have been assigned to monitor Big Brother: 8 for any hint of criminal behaviour. And, God help them, monitoring means watching everything and not just the Little Brother highlights with Dermot O'Leary. Yes, the world has come to this. The line-up bears no hint at care taken over shaping the action post-Shetty. For a start, it's all women -- for now --which should do wonders for minimising the bitching and bullying. Further, the mix is classic BB, designed to cause trouble, comprising a militant; a conservative; some twits obsessed with the colour pink; a Posh-lookalike with wannabe etched through her like a stick of rock; a hottie who dates footballers; and a pair of older women no doubt expected to disapprove of the younger generation. Sending in some mammies, perhaps, is show creator, Endemol's idea of policing the proceedings. When Big Brother began, it was all about voyeurism. It was grubby, but it was fun, until it morphed into a maker of minor celebrities who believe being watched equals being wanted. As Orwell saw it, constant observation was one of the worst things that could happen to a society. He wasn't wrong, as I'm sure the BB-watching bobbies would testify. Sarah Caden nodisharmony ![]() |
